Frequently Asked Questions

Should I install traditional shingles now or wait and get solar shingles later?

With current 1:1 net metering and the 30% federal Investment Tax Credit, integrated solar shingles are a viable long-term investment. However, for a home needing immediate replacement, high-quality architectural asphalt shingles applied with proper solar-ready flashing and conduit chases is often the more pragmatic 2026 choice. It addresses the urgent need for storm resilience and insurance relief today, while preserving all options for a future solar panel or shingle add-on.

What does '140 mph wind rating' actually mean for my shingle choice?

The 140 mph Ultimate Design Wind Speed (Vult) from ASCE 7-22 is the engineered wind load your roof structure must resist. For the shingles themselves, achieving a UL 2218 Class 4 impact rating is the parallel requirement for hail and debris. Using Class 4 shingles is a financial necessity; they are far less likely to be damaged by the moderate hail common here during peak hurricane season, preventing costly granular loss and leaks that lead to insurance claims.

I have high energy bills and attic mold. Could my roof ventilation be wrong?

Very likely. A 4/12 pitch roof in our climate requires a balanced system of intake (soffit) and exhaust (ridge) vents per the 2023 Florida Building Code. An imbalanced system traps superheated, moist air in the attic. This cooks the shingles from below, drastically shortening their life, and creates condensation that leads to mold on the decking and trusses. Proper ventilation is a non-negotiable component of a durable roof assembly.

My shingles look worn and I see some curling. How much life does my roof have left?

Homes in Silver Springs Shores built around 1993 are seeing 30+ year-old architectural asphalt shingles near the end of their service life. The 7/16" OSB decking beneath is resilient, but decades of Florida's intense UV and moisture cycles degrade the shingle's asphalt and granules. This leads to embrittlement, curling, and reduced wind uplift resistance, which is a critical failure point as these roofs were not originally designed for today's 140 mph wind zone requirements.

My homeowner's insurance premium just jumped again. Can a new roof really lower my bill?

Yes, directly. Insurers in Florida are pricing risk based on outdated roofing systems. Upgrading to an IBHS FORTIFIED Roof standard, which is actively credited under the My Safe Florida Home Program, signals superior storm resilience. This demonstrable risk reduction often results in significant premium discounts, offsetting a portion of the investment. In the current market, a non-fortified roof is a financial liability.

What are the big code changes for a roof replacement that my handyman might not know?

The 2023 Florida Building Code, enforced by the Marion County Building Safety Department, mandates critical upgrades. This includes a 6-foot ice and water shield strip at all eaves and in valleys, enhanced drip edge details, and specific fastener patterns for 7/16" OSB decking. Any contractor must hold a valid license from the Florida Construction Industry Licensing Board. Unpermitted work or code violations can void your insurance and complicate a future sale.
